Helen C. Guida

August 28, 1915 — April 1, 2012

Helen Christine (Paulson) Guida was born to Paul and Molly (Olsen) Paulson on August 28, 1915 on the family farm three miles north of Tyler, Minnesota. She attended country school one mile west of the farm and completed her education at the Tyler Public School. Helen married Don Guida at her parent’s home in Tyler on October 26, 1938. The newlyweds moved onto the Paulson farm. Their marriage was blessed with six children and 50 years of life together. Their family worked together on their dairy farm, with the priorities in the home being a good work ethic and their Christian faith.

Don and Helen retired and moved into Tyler in 1974. Don died and Helen later moved to Danebod Village in 2000. She enjoyed her home and looked forward to special family get-togethers. She was a gracious hostess, and her home provided a wonderful place for family and friends to gather. She always decorated for the seasons, and especially enjoyed holiday celebrations by sharing her cooking and the traditions she loved. Helen died on Sunday, April 1, 2012 at Tyler Healthcare Center at the age of 96 years, 7 months, and 30 days.

Helen was a lifetime member of the Christian & Missionary Alliance Church in Tyler. Her faith in Christ was her daily strength. She loved playing the piano, taught Sunday School, and was an active member of the Alliance women’s group. She enjoyed doing cross-stitch and embroidery, and she crocheted an afghan for each of her seventeen grandchildren for their graduations. She was an avid fan of the Minnesota Twins.

Helen is lovingly remembered by her children, Mavis (and Ron) Shriver of Woodbury, Minnesota, Dan (and Sandy) Guida of Red Wing, Minnesota, David (and Kathy) Guida of Tyler, Minnesota, and Darla (and Curt) Madsen of Tyler, Minnesota; 17 grandchildren; 30 great-grandchildren; 6 great-great-grandchildren; son-in-law Al (and Linda) Carlson of Minnesota City, Minnesota; and many other relatives and friends. She was preceded in death by her husband, Don; her parents; two daughters, Betty and Karen; and great-granddaughter, Payton.
